Who is Sara Haines?

Sara Haines is an American television host and journalist, widely recognized for her roles on ABC’s daytime talk show The View and the game show The Chase. Born on September 18, 1977, in Newton, Iowa, she graduated with a Bachelor of Arts in government from Smith College. Her career began in the NBC Page Program, which led to positions as a production coordinator for Today and later as a correspondent for Good Morning America.

In addition to her work on The View, Haines has co-hosted Strahan, Sara and Keke and made a return to The View as a permanent co-host in 2020. Throughout her career, Haines has been recognized for her significant contributions to television journalism, earning multiple Daytime Emmy Award nominations. Her versatile career has made her a well-respected figure in the world of daytime television.

Sara Haines educational background

Haines graduated with a Bachelor of Arts degree in government from Smith College in Northampton, Massachusetts, in 2000. While at Smith, she was actively engaged in sports, playing both basketball and volleyball.

Sara Haines dating life, spouse and children

Haines married attorney Max Shifrin, whom she met on the dating site OkCupid. They tied the knot in November 2014 and have three children: Alec Richard Shifrin (born March 5, 2016), Sandra Grace Shifrin (born December 23, 2017), and Caleb Joseph Shifrin. Their love story began when Haines created an online dating profile for a Good Morning America segment and decided to keep it active, which eventually led her to connect with Shifrin.

Sara Haines’ parents and siblings

Haines’ parents are Richard (“Dick”) and Sandra (“Sandy”) Haines. She was raised in a close-knit family with her three siblings: Susanne Haines, Joseph (“Joe”) Haines, and Kathryn Haines.

Sara Haines career

Haines began her career in the NBC Page Program, which paved the way for her role as a production coordinator on Today in 2002. In 2009, she became a contributing correspondent for the show’s fourth hour, building her presence in the industry. Her journey continued when she transitioned to ABC News in 2013, serving as a correspondent and pop news anchor for Good Morning America.

In 2016, Haines joined The View as a permanent co-host, where she quickly became a familiar face. However, in 2018, she left the show to co-host GMA Day, which was later rebranded as Strahan, Sara and Keke. After the show’s reformatting in 2020, Haines made a return to The View as a full-time co-host, continuing her influential role in daytime television.

In 2021, Haines took on the role of host for ABC’s revival of The Chase, while also making a cameo appearance in The Falcon and the Winter Soldier. Her significant contributions to television journalism have earned her several Daytime Emmy Award nominations. In recognition of her achievements, her hometown of Newton, Iowa, celebrated “Sara Haines Day” in 2022.
